The Administrators guide is a great starting point. Chapter 15 specifically addresses disaster planning and recovery. http://support.veritas.com/docs/288005 As far a specific set of processes for "best practices", there are far too many variables (SQL, Exchange, O/S versions, etc.) to produce a concise document. Again, the Admin Guide has processes documented for disaster recovery for these different scenarios.
